THE OLD TIMERS REPORT

FOR THE MEMBERS OF THE DELAWARE COUNTY FIELD & STREAM ASSOCIATION.

Written By Ben Mower

 


May 2009

 


The Old Timers League Went Trapshooting

 

 

The shoot started in April and ended in June. Everyone shot their best shot guns and trust me there were many different makes and models being used. There were no separate classes everyone shot at 25 clay birds from the same distance each Monday. The scoring was done by what is known as Lewis Class from the lowest score up. Sorry I can not explain this scoring. Again the shoot took place every Monday starting around 11 AM for 5 weeks.

 

Of the 15 entries 11 shooters competed for the full 5 weeks. The conditions were typical weather for this time of the year rain, rain and more rain. There were three rain outs and a holiday so it took 9 weeks to complete the shoot. The competition was close and not so close depending on one’s ability at this sport; again there were individual rivalries. Each contestant kept a keen eye on their competition and the scoring. Some heckling could be heard and was expected. Equipment was checked very closely.
